Latest Patents

Hsieh-Fu Tsai holds a patent for a "3D polymeric insert to apply uniform electric field in circular cultureware." This invention discloses an insert designed for circular-shaped petri dishes that generates a substantially uniform electric field across the dish filled with fluid, establishing a salt bridge. The insert features a circular-shaped bottom plate that defines a circular space, a side channel that vertically extends from the bottom plate's periphery, and a pair of current rectifying chambers. The design ensures that the circular-shaped space exhibits a uniform electric field throughout its area when the salt bridge is established. Hsieh-Fu Tsai has 1 patent to his name.
